Homewatch Caregivers is an in-home care service with a reputation for empowering seniors to enjoy the freedom and independence of living in their own homes. We work alongside clients, their family members, and their medical team to develop a care plan that best fits their needs and lifestyle. Our flexible scheduling allows us to provide services ranging from a few hours a day to around-the-clock, live-in assistance.
Each member of our care team has undergone careful screening and training, helping to ensure we are always able to provide a high standard of care and support for each family that we serve.
With Homewatch Caregivers, seniors enjoy the support and care they need to enjoy a high quality of life in their own homes, while their family members have peace of mind that important needs are being met. We’re proud of our caregivers and the outstanding service they provide, and we look forward to meeting with you to best understand how we can serve your safe and healthy lifestyle.

They were very excited about the prospect of being able to obtain a Full Skilled patient (Mom) for 24/7 care but they failed to do a serious evaluation of their own personnel resources to make sure they weren't over-extending themselves knowing that we were in search of ONE competent, reliable, and communicative service. They failed on all counts early in the care of Mom and needed to be removed as the Primary Service. They overstated their capabilities in terms of personnel familiar with patients as complex as Mom as well as being unable to consistently assign reliable and experienced caregivers to her case.

We are using Homewatch Care Givers to provide care givers that come to my mother's home for 4 hours each morning. They feed her breakfast and lunch and give her medication. The care givers are caring and well liked by my mother and follow all the directions that we leave. They always leave a note to let us know how things went that day. We did have a few glitches in the beginning that were quickly resolved. My suggestion to anyone with a caregiver coming to their home is to make sure that they call in to the company to let them know they have arrived.
